mobsync.h-Header

Dieser Header wird von der Windows-Shell verwendet. Weitere Informationen finden Sie unter

mobsync.h enthält die folgenden Programmierschnittstellen:

Schnittstellen

 
ISyncMgrEnumItems

Macht Methoden verfügbar, die über ein Array von SYNCMGRITEM-Strukturen auflisten.
ISyncMgrRegister

Macht Methoden verfügbar, damit sich eine Anwendung beim Synchronisierungs-Manager registrieren kann. Dies kann entweder über die ISyncMgrRegister-Schnittstelle oder durch direkte Registrierung in der Registrierung erreicht werden.
ISyncMgrSynchronize

Macht Methoden verfügbar, die es der registrierten Anwendung oder dem registrierten Dienst ermöglichen, Benachrichtigungen vom Synchronisierungs-Manager zu empfangen.
ISyncMgrSynchronizeCallback

Macht Methoden verfügbar, die den Synchronisierungsprozess verwalten.
ISyncMgrSynchronizeInvoke

Macht Methoden verfügbar, die es einer registrierten Anwendung ermöglichen, den Synchronisierungs-Manager aufzurufen, um Elemente zu aktualisieren.

Strukturen

 
SYNCMGRHANDLERINFO

Stellt Informationen zum Handler bereit, der in der ISyncMgrSynchronize::GetHandlerInfo-Methode verwendet werden kann.
SYNCMGRITEM

Stellt Informationen zu Elementen bereit, die von der ISyncMgrEnumItems-Schnittstelle aufgezählt werden.
SYNCMGRLOGERRORINFO

Stellt Fehlerinformationen zur Verwendung in der ISyncMgrSynchronizeCallback::LogError-Methode bereit.
SYNCMGRPROGRESSITEM

Stellt status Informationen bereit, während eine Synchronisierung ausgeführt wird. Diese Struktur wird mit der ISyncMgrSynchronizeCallback::P rogress-Methode verwendet und entspricht einem einzelnen Synchronisierungselement.

Enumerationen

 
SYNCMGRFLAG

Die SYNCMGRFLAG-Enumerationswerte werden in der ISyncMgrSynchronize::Initialize-Methode verwendet, um anzugeben, wie das Synchronisierungsereignis initiiert wurde.
SYNCMGRHANDLERFLAGS

Wird in der SYNCMGRHANDLERINFO-Struktur als Flags verwendet, die für den aktuellen Handler gelten.
SYNCMGRINVOKEFLAGS

Der SYNCMGRINVOKEFLAGS-Enumerationswert gibt an, wie der Synchronisierungs-Manager in der ISyncMgrSynchronizeInvoke::UpdateItems-Methode aufgerufen werden soll.
SYNCMGRITEMFLAGS

Gibt Informationen für das aktuelle Element in der SYNCMGRITEM-Struktur an.
SYNCMGRLOGLEVEL

Die SYNCMGRLOGLEVEL-Enumerationswerte geben eine Fehlerstufe für die Verwendung in der ISyncMgrSynchronizeCallback::LogError-Methode an.
SYNCMGRREGISTERFLAGS

Die SYNCMGRREGISTERFLAGS-Enumerationswerte werden in Methoden der ISyncMgrRegister-Schnittstelle verwendet, um Ereignisse zu identifizieren, für die der Handler registriert ist, um benachrichtigt zu werden.
SYNCMGRSTATUS

Wird in der ISyncMgrSynchronize::SetItemStatus-Methode verwendet, um die aktualisierte status für das Element anzugeben.